Crime log

Disorderly Conduct

Gelman Library Starbucks
2/19/2016 – 2:50 p.m.
Case closed

University Police Department officers responded to a disorderly individual. The non-affiliated man was barred and escorted from campus.

– Subject barred

Assault With Dangerous Weapon

Off Campus
2/19/2016 – 3 a.m.
Case closed

UPD officers responded to an assault that occurred off campus and made contact with the Metropolitan Police Department. MPD arrested a male student who was chasing another male student with a butter knife.

– Subject arrested

Weapons Violation

West Hall
2/20/2016 – Unknown Time
Open case

A female student reported to UPD that she found a single round of ammunition in the washing machine.

– Ongoing investigation

Theft

23rd & H Street NW
2/20/2016 – 9 a.m. – 5:18 p.m.
Case closed

A female student reported that multiple electronics were missing from her vehicle.

– No suspects or witnesses

Disorderly Conduct

Off Campus
2/21/2016 – 3:31 a.m.
Case closed

MPD reported to UPD that a male student was urinating in public.

– Subject arrested

Drug and Liquor Law Violation

Thurston Hall
2/21/2016 – 2 a.m.
Case closed

UPD officers responded to an administrative room search which yielded alcohol, mushrooms, marijuana, drug paraphernalia, excess cash and stolen GW property. MPD responded and transported a male student to Second District police station.

– Subject arrested, referred for disciplinary action

Theft, Destruction and Liquor Law Violation

Thurston Hall
2/21/2016 – 12:30 a.m.
Case closed

UPD officers responded to the report of two damaged GWorld card readers and a broken water fountain. A suspected male student was located by UPD and it was determined that the male student was under the influence of alcohol. UPD arrested the male student and MPD responded.

– Subject arrested, referred for disciplinary action

Receiving Stolen Property, Drug and Liquor Law Violation

Thurston Hall
2/21/2016 – 11:15 p.m.
Case closed

UPD officers responded to an administrative room search which yielded marijuana, alcohol and stolen GW property.

– Referred for disciplinary action

– Compiled by Sam Eppler.
